WARNING: Please double and triple check the wiring, especially of the battery power line, before connecting the battery. For example: Do everything, which is possible to do without a connected battery, without a battery when the battery shall be connected the first time or after a modification, connect it first to the STorM32 board with all NT modules disconnected connect the NT modules one by one don't connect/disconnect NT modules when a battery is connected. For setup it is thus strongly recommended to be most careful and follow procedures which minimize the risks. This bears some risks, since the 3.3 V electronics will almost certainly be destroyed when it comes into contact with the battery voltage. For instance, the NT-X plugs carry both of them. The T-STorM32 concept brings the battery power line and the control lines for the 3.3 V electronics in close proximity. Thus, before using the GUI ensure that the STorM32 controller has been put into the desired mode, see Switching to T-STorM32 Mode. The GUI detects the mode and adapts itself accordingly the active mode can always be inferred from the GUI's window title.Ĭomment: The available parameters and options in the GUI are different in the encoder T-STorM32 and the conventional STorM32 mode. It however implies that the firmware needs to be switched to T-STorM32 mode, before T-STorM32 can be used. ![]() compare and evaluate performance differences in the two modes. The firmware allows us to run the encoder T-STorM32 and the conventional STorM32 versions intermittently, by simply setting a flag via the GUI's, without the need of any modifications to the hardware. This results in a two-step configuration procedure: First the "NT motor-encoder module + motor" unit is configured, and then in a second step the settings in the STorM32 controller board are made.Ĭomment: In the following the NT motor-encoder modules are also denoted as "NT motor modules" for brevity. the motors or the encoders are directly connected to the main STorM32 controller board, are not supported (if you want to know why, this picture here shows one of the several reasons).įrom the perspective of the STorM32 controller, a motor and its associated NT motor-encoder module is regarded as one combined unit, and the STorM32 controller doesn't need to know about this unit's internals. It consists of a main STorM32 controller board, NT motor-encoder modules, and a camera NT IMU module.
